Paylines

Paylines in slot games are simulated lines that are a part of the reels and help determine whether you have a winning combination. They may be in a zigzag pattern or simple and straight. If three or more symbols match on an activated payline, the game will pay out your winnings. Certain slot machines have fixed paylines while others have paylines that you can change depending on your preferences.

The paytable is the first thing you check when you play slot machines to know the number of paylines and the various ways you can win. This information is crucial to know as it will aid you in determining the amount to be spent per spin and the payouts to anticipate. It's also essential to read the rules of every slot game, as it will give you more insight into the game's mechanics as well as its rules.

The most common method of playing in a slot machine is to match symbols on paylines that trigger in a row from left to right. However, many modern slot machines use different systems that eliminate the traditional payline framework and provide a wider range of possible combinations. This type of system is known as 'ways to win' and ranges in size between one and 100.

Bonus rounds

Bonus rounds in slot games are special features that offer players more chances to be awarded prizes. These mini-games can take many forms, from pick-and-click games to thrilling adventures that include multiple stages and increasing rewards. These features, whether they include multipliers or expanding wilds can increase the chances of winning significant payouts. They offer an additional level of strategy and are perfect for players who prefer to gamble in a more thoughtful manner.

Some bonus rounds are re-triggerable, while others require certain symbols to appear in a particular sequence on the reels. The number of symbols required to trigger a bonus game may differ based on the slot's rules. Certain slots permit players to trigger the bonus round only once per spin. Others let you play it a number of times for an unlimited amount of time. To learn more about the rules for the bonus round in a slot game, players should always consult its paytable. The information should be clearly displayed on the interface of the game, usually under Settings, Options, Autoplay, or Help buttons.
